    On this episode of Embedded Insiders, Ken sits down with Kudelski Labs' Senior Vice President leading the Go-to-Market team, Christoph Nichols. The two discuss Edge AI Security, diving into the company's secure-by-design engineering approach that helps manufacturers develop and deploy products safely through their entire lifecycle.

    Next, Rich and Steve Hanna, a Distinguished Engineer at Infineon, discuss the crossroads between embedded devices needing updates and patches for bug fixes and security vulnerabilities, and the fact that these devices may not have the memory space to do so.  What do you do?

    On this episode of Embedded Insiders, we're discussing the continued evolution of Ambient IoT with Giampaolo Marino, Chief Strategy and Growth Officer at Energous. We're diving into battery dependency, the benefits of continuous, always-on data for AI, and how the company's partnership with e-peas supports battery-free sensor deployments through wireless power and energy harvesting.
    Next, Rich and Ann Olivo, the Vice-President of Marketing for the Thread Group, discuss the Thread standard. Thread is part of the IEEE 802.15.4 wireless protocol and operates at very low power. The two discuss the importance of the protocol and the newly unveiled app that simplifies the process for developers.

Hosted on the www.embeddedcomputing.com website, the Embedded Insiders Podcast is a fun electronics talk show for hardware design engineers, software developers, and academics. Organized by Tiera Oliver, Assistant Managing Editor, and Ken Briodagh, Editor-in-Chief of Embedded Computing Design, each episode highlights embedded industry veterans who tackle trends, news, and new products for the embedded, IoT, automotive, security, artificial intelligence, edge computing, and other technology marketplaces in a light and accessible format.
